#639633 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#639633 is composed of 38.8% red, 58.8%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34% cyan, 0% magenta, 66%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 90.9 degrees, a saturation of 49.3% and a lightness of 39.4%. #639633 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ff66 with #002d00.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

● #639633 color description : Dark moderate green.
#639633 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#639633 has RGB values of R:99, G:150, B:51 and CMYK values of C:0.34, M:0, Y:0.66,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 6526515.

Shades and Tints of #639633
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020401 is the darkest color, while #f8fbf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#639633
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646861 is the less saturated color, while #62c405 is the most saturated one.
